locks: linker variables to calculate per-cpu bakery lock size

This patch introduces explicit linker variables to mark the start and
end of the per-cpu bakery lock section to help bakery_lock_normal.c
calculate the size of the section. This patch removes the previously
used '__PERCPU_BAKERY_LOCK_SIZE__' linker variable to make the code
uniform across GNU linker and ARM linker.
